Job Description

This is an exciting opportunity for a Group Treasury Analyst to join my client's dynamic team. Reporting to the Group Treasury Manager, this role plays a pivotal part in managing the day-to-day operations of the Group Treasury Function while contributing to strategic initiatives during a time of change and growth.

With broad exposure across the Group, you'll interact daily with businesses in the UK, France, Belgium, Spain, Portugal, and Germany, ensuring the effective management of cash, working capital, and external debt facilities. This is an excellent opportunity to influence change and make a meaningful impact at a Group level.

Key Responsibilities

Internal Lending Facilities:

  • Prepare and maintain inter-company loan agreements and interest calculations (including forecasts).
  • Process payments for inter-company draw down requests.
  • Post month-end treasury journals related to inter-company loans.


External Borrowing Facilities:
  • Prepare utilisation requests for loan draw downs.
  • Ensure compliance with loan agreements, including repayments, interest payments, and covenant reporting.
  • Recalculate external interest to ensure accuracy.


Treasury Operations
  • Manage bank account operations, including account opening/closing, KYC requirements, and cash pool arrangements.
  • Monitor daily cash balances.
  • Own the payment process for all treasury-related payments and transfers.
  • Ensure treasury accounting in Oracle reconciles fully to supporting schedules. (Bank reconciliations and cashbook postings are handled by the Treasury Assistant, but you'll provide cover when needed.


Cash and Working Capital Optimisation
  • Manage the Group's short-term cash flow requirements.
  • Work closely with subsidiaries to ensure efficient management of cash and external borrowings.
  • Identify opportunities to optimise cash and working capital across the Group.
  • Monitor subsidiary cash balances against targets and challenge local teams as necessary.


Additional Responsibilities
  • Operate and enhance the Group's Treasury SOX controls.
  • Assist with automating payment processes within the ERP system.
  • Support cost-benefit analyses and potential implementation of a Treasury Management System (TMS).
  • Drive process improvements and support other areas of the Group Treasury team as needed.
